Steelers Induct Ben Roethlisberger, Joey Porter and Maurkice Pouncey Into Hall of Honor

Roethlisberger delivered heartfelt thanks to Steelers fans during the Acrisure Stadium ceremony.

Overview

  • The Class of 2025 was recognized at halftime of the Steelers–Dolphins game at Acrisure Stadium.
  • Roethlisberger grew emotional on stage, praising Steelers Nation during his acceptance.
  • Across 18 Pittsburgh seasons, Roethlisberger recorded 165 wins, 64,088 passing yards and 418 touchdowns with two Super Bowl titles.
  • Eligibility for the Steelers Hall of Honor requires at least three seasons with the team and three years of retirement.
  • Porter reflected on the 2005 championship run as a "revenge tour," and Roethlisberger recently cited Brandin Echols as a team MVP candidate on his podcast.
